Senior Construction Manager Salary in Fort Myers, FL: $162,983 (2026)

Quick Answer:The top tier of construction managers working in Fort Myers, FL — those at or above the 90th percentile — pull in $162,983/year or more for 2026, based on BLS OEWS 2025 estimates for SOC 11-9021. Strip back Fort Myers's price premium (BEA RPP 100.8, 1% above national) and that top-decile pay carries the same buying power as $161,689 in average-cost America. The 55% spread above city median typically rewards 7+ years of practice or specialty credentials.

Maximizing Your Construction Manager Earnings in Fort Myers

In this evolving job market, certain areas of specialization can lead to enhanced pay for senior construction managers in Fort Myers. Professionals focusing on commercial and healthcare construction, such as hospitals, find themselves in high demand, especially given the ongoing infrastructure projects in the region. Similarly, expertise in data center construction has surged, providing lucrative opportunities as this specialty evolves. Compensation can vary significantly depending on the employer type; those employed by top-tier general contractors like Bechtel or Skanska USA tend to enjoy higher salaries compared to those in smaller firms or those working as owners' representatives. The route to higher positions is often paved by gaining advanced certifications like CCM or PMP, coupled with years of experience. Additional compensation drivers, such as project size and complexity, as well as the potential for bonuses tied to project profitability, can further elevate earnings beyond base salaries in the Fort Myers area.
